[ATTENTION: This review reveals content of the movie.]
I hate this movie because it tries to erase the very reality of the relationship between males and women in french ghettos. In this movie, a teenage girl is being beatten by a guy for no real reason. But the director far from condemning this agresion is kind of condescending with it. Moreover the scenario and the general mood of the movie reminds me so much the book of Samira Bellil that it is very close to plagiarism. It is almost as if the director had taken the book, erased the gang rapes part and replace it by a love story. Good idea but he forgot to suppress all the physical violence against the women. I would like to remind all the readers that the reality of the life in french ghettos as explained in the book of Samira bellil:Dans L'Enfer Des Tournantes (In The Hell Of tournantes) Published in 2002, it had made her immediately infamous, because it was the first time a young woman had dared to reveal the reality of life in the deprived ghettos - the banlieue - of French cities. I consider myself as fluent in french but with this movie I must admit that either I am not or as the other critics seem to imply the language used is pidgin. The young actors are goog but the movie is incredibly boring. A lot of yelling, a lot of violence and a twisted message from the réalisator. A very bad movie when compared to: "la haine".
